| CD66D family | | SUBUNIT: Interacts with S100A9/calprotectin. This interaction is calcium-dependent, but independent of CEACAM3 phosphorylation. |
| CD66D Subcellular locations | | SUBCELLULAR LOCATION: Membrane; Single-pass type I membrane protein. |
| CD66D FUNCTION According to UniProtKB Swiss Prot | | Major granulocyte receptor mediating recognition and efficient opsonin-independent phagocytosis of CEACAM-binding microorganisms, including Neissiria, Moxarella and Haemophilus species, thus playing an important role in the clearance of pathogens by the innate immune system. Responsible for RAC1 stimulation in the course of pathogen phagocytosis. |
